Abstract
The utility model provides a baffle of an engine mount and an engine mount assembly. A gap is formed between the side wall of an installation support of the engine mount and an installation hole of an auxiliary frame. The baffle is characterized by comprising a sleeve body and a baffle body. One end of the sleeve body is fixed to the baffle face of the baffle body, the inner wall of the sleeve body is matched with the side wall of the installation support, the outer wall of the sleeve body is matched with the installation hole, the baffle face is attached to the auxiliary frame, and the baffle body is provided with a through hole used for a mount pull rod to pass through. The baffle is simple and compact in structure and effectively reduces wind noise of a vehicle.

Background technology
Existing Engine Mounting System mainly adopts two kinds of arrangements: four-point suspension system and bikini suspension system.In four-point suspension system, left suspending born the main weight of dynamic assembly with right suspending, rear-suspending or front-suspension play the effect of supplemental support, simultaneously front-suspension and rear-suspending are also born the main torsional pulse of dynamic assembly, and the biddability of four-point suspension system and vehicle frame is bad, anti-vibration performance is poor.In bikini suspension system, a left side suspends and right suspending born the main weight of dynamic assembly, and rear-suspending is born the main torsional pulse of dynamic assembly.Because the vibration isolation of bikini suspension system is better than four-point suspension system, so the horizontal preposition precursor vehicle of main flow mostly adopts bikini suspension system.
But there are the following problems for the rear-suspending of bikini suspension system: rear-suspending is mainly born engine torque output, therefore in order to realize the longer arm of force, the stressed minimum that makes to suspend, rear-suspending assembly is generally arranged in the least significant end of dynamic assembly.But this kind of arrangement form is exposed under car body the mounting bracket of rear-suspending and the junction of subframe, between mounting hole on sidewall and the subframe of mounting bracket, there is gap, when vehicle high-speed is advanced, under car body, this gap of fast speed airflow passes can produce air-flow noise, thereby increased the car load noise under high-speed cruising, NVH(Noise, the Vibration of vehicle, Harshness, noise, vibration and sound vibration roughness) poor-performing.

The specific embodiment
Below in conjunction with accompanying drawing, specific embodiment of the utility model is described in detail.
As shown in Fig. 1~4, between mounting hole 61 on sidewall 32 and the subframe 6 of the mounting bracket 3 of engine mounting, there is gap, the baffle plate 1 of engine mounting comprises body 11 and plate body 12, one end of body 11 is fixed on the plate face 121 of plate body 12, the inwall 111 of body 11 coordinates with the sidewall 32 of mounting bracket 3, the outer wall 112 of body 11 coordinates with mounting hole 61, and plate face 121 fits with subframe 6, and described plate body 12 has the through hole 122 passing through for the pull bar 2 that suspends.Body 11 is tubular, and the inner wall shape of body 11 is consistent with the sidewall 32 of mounting bracket 3, and outer wall 112 shapes of body 11 are consistent with the shape of mounting hole 61.Above-mentioned " inwall " refers to the part wall body coordinating with mounting bracket 3, and " outer wall " refers to the part wall body coordinating with mounting hole 61.
The plate face 121 of baffle plate 1 easily shakes, misplaces, and therefore, can on plate face 121, increase securing device, and preferred, plate body 12 has flange 123, and flange 123 coordinates with the upper limb 62 of subframe 6.Flange 123 blocks the upper limb 62 of subframe 6, makes baffle plate 1 be connected more firm with subframe 6.
The material of baffle plate 1 can be rubber, plastic or other material, and preferred, the material of baffle plate 1 is rubber, and body 11 is fixed and is connected by bonding by Vulcanization with mounting bracket 3.Baffle plate 1 is fixed together by bonding by Vulcanization with mounting bracket 3, has strengthened Joint strenght and tightness.
The through hole of plate body 12, the size of body 11 can have multiple variation, and preferred, body 11 is vertically installed on plate face 121, and the shape of through hole 122 is consistent with the shape of the endoporus 114 of body 11.Endoporus 114 fingers of body 11 and the endoporus 114 of plate face 121 contact positions.Endoporus 114 can be identical with the size of inwall 111.Adopt the baffle plate 1 of this structure simple in structure, save material, be convenient to machine-shaping.
As shown in Figure 5, Figure 6, engine mounting assembly comprises baffle plate 1, the pull bar 2 that suspends, mounting bracket 3, mounting bracket 3 is located in the mounting hole 61 of subframe 6 and is fixedly connected with subframe 6, the pull bar 2 that suspends is fixedly connected with mounting bracket 3, the body 11 of baffle plate 1 inserts in the gap between mounting bracket 3 and mounting hole 61, the pull bar 2 that suspends passes the through hole 122 of plate body 12, and plate face 121 and the subframe 6 of baffle plate 1 fit.
Suspend and can directly be connected between pull bar 2 and mounting bracket 3, also can connect by elastic component.Preferably, engine mounting assembly comprises cone rubber cover 4 and adapter plate 5, mounting bracket 3 inside have flange 31, the number of cone rubber cover 4 is two, the large end 41 of two cone rubber covers 4 all props up flange 31, the small end 42 of two cone rubber covers 4 props up respectively suspend pull bar 2 and adapter plate 5, and adapter plate 5 is fixedly connected with the pull bar 2 that suspends.Suspend and between pull bar 2 and mounting bracket 3, by cone rubber, overlap 4 and be connected, there is the effect of good vibration isolation and shock absorbing.
